520 _aa single mirror reflects the truth as it is but only from one perspective. A ˜hall of mirrors, on the other hand, exposes the truth through overlapping reflections, with varying depths and from a wide range of perspectives. In this book, political scientist Peter Ronald deSouza places India at the centre of such a hall of mirrors. He reveals for the reader the layered nature of Indian democracy, one particular depth, one particular perspective at a time.</br> < em> in the hall of mirrors </em> discusses the dynamics of democracy and the nature of the human condition in India through a range of multidisciplinary, analytical and methodological tools. It documents our achievements and failures, follies and humanity, through the fall and rise of competing ideologies. The essays here, written over the course of the past two decades, document the aspirations and anxieties of the Indian people, the accommodations that our plural society has made, and the uncertainties and ambivalences that remain as a result of this grand experiment of and in democracy.</br> With this eclectic collection of his writings in journals and popular dailies, the author takes us through an array of issues facing us. At every turn and in every corner, he reflects on the resilience of India's democracy, the worlds largest and most challenging.
